Knowsley Hospital and Home Tuition Service
If a child is absent from school for 15 days due to health needs that can be evidenced by a medical professional, they may be referred to the Hospital and Home Tuition Service. The aim of The Hospital and Home Tuition Service is to support Children and Young People with medical needs to access education either in the hospital or at home. Each child will require a tailored plan which will meet their individual needs. Advice from the medical practitioner will be used to determine the amount of tuition offered.
The service will liaise with the school and other agencies/teams in the interests of the CYP so that the barriers to educational achievement are reduced.
